Le Souffleur is a breathtaking natural site located in L'Escalier, Mauritius. Famous for its dramatic blowholes, this stunning coastal attraction offers visitors a unique experience of nature's power and beauty. Witness the ocean waves crashing against the rocks, sending plumes of water high into the air, especially during high tide. Surrounded by picturesque landscapes, this location is perfect for photography, picnics, and enjoying the fresh sea breeze.

    Getting There

    Walking

    From Poste de Flacq, head south on the main road towards L'Escalier. Continue straight for about 2.5 kilometers until you reach the intersection with the coastal road. Turn left onto the coastal road (B45) and walk for approximately 1 kilometer. You will pass by several local shops and restaurants. Keep following the road until you see signs for Le Souffleur. The entrance will be on your right, marked by a small sign and the natural landscape.

    Public Transport (Bus)

    From Poste de Flacq, walk to the nearest bus stop located outside the Poste de Flacq market. Take a bus heading towards L'Escalier. Make sure to ask the driver to drop you off at the stop for Le Souffleur or near L'Escalier. The bus ride will take around 10-15 minutes. Once you get off, walk back a short distance until you see the entrance to Le Souffleur, which will be on your left.

    Local tips

    Visit during high tide for the best blowhole displays.
    Bring a camera to capture the stunning coastal views.
    Consider visiting early in the morning to avoid crowds and enjoy the tranquility.
    Wear comfortable shoes for exploring the rocky terrain around the blowholes.
    Pack a picnic to enjoy while soaking in the beautiful scenery.

    Discover more about Le Souffleur

    Le Souffleur is one of Mauritius' most captivating natural attractions, nestled along the coast of L'Escalier. This incredible site is renowned for its dramatic blowholes, where waves crash against the rocky coastline, creating spectacular jets of water that shoot high into the air. Visitors are often mesmerized by the sheer power of the ocean and the beauty of the surrounding scenery, making it a prime spot for both relaxation and adventure. The best time to visit is during high tide, when the blowholes are at their most impressive. The sound of the crashing waves and the cool sea spray add to the exhilarating experience, making it a must-see for anyone visiting the island. The area also offers picturesque views, ideal for photography enthusiasts seeking to capture the stunning landscapes of Mauritius. Beyond the blowholes, the surrounding coastal region features lush vegetation and scenic pathways perfect for leisurely walks or picnics with family and friends. The accessibility of Le Souffleur makes it a popular destination for both locals and tourists alike, and its natural beauty is sure to leave a lasting impression. Whether you are seeking adventure or a tranquil spot to enjoy the ocean breeze, Le Souffleur offers a unique blend of both, inviting visitors to immerse themselves in the natural wonders of this beautiful island.
